Web1 day ago · North Korea's missile tests began with short-range missiles aimed at South Korea, followed by mid-range ones capable of reaching Japan. The country then proceeded to test its advanced intercontinental ballistic missile, the Hwasong 17, which can hit the US mainland, demonstrating the full range and scope of its missile technology. WebBelieved to be about 82 feet long, the Hwasong-17 is the North's longest-range weapon and, by some estimates, the world's biggest road-mobile ballistic missile system.
